A Haven for Wildlife Lovers
The Tadoba-Andhari Tiger Reserve spans over 1,700 square kilometers and is home to a rich biodiversity. It is particularly renowned for its significant population of Bengal tigers, making it a top choice for tourists seeking tiger safaris. Apart from tigers, visitors may also encounter leopards, sloth bears, wild dogs, hyenas, marsh crocodiles, and over 195 species of birds.

Best Time to Visit Tadoba
The park is open from October to June, with peak tiger sightings typically occurring in the hotter months between March and May. During this time, animals are often spotted near water bodies, offering thrilling opportunities for photography.
